Today I walked on my second CAD session in which I created LNA weatherproof enclosure and its lid. This was the most crucial part because the ground station in which it will protect ₹5000 amplifier from Indian monsoon rain.
The enclosure is 75x45x25mm PETG at 100% infill with 3mm walls, three connector holes, and internal screw posts. I also completed the short RF coaxial cable mount.
